New twist in story of three teenage girls declared missing



The media yesterday went wild with the news of three girls declared missing in Bamenda, North West Region, and found in the nation’s capital Yaounde.

Family sources had indicted a pastor for keeping them away from their relatives.



Sources close to the Pastor however, say she only acted as a rescuer to the kids, and has not been keeping them hostage.

A source familiar with the story says her Pastor was simply being a good samaritan, before getting entangled in the situation.


Contrary to earlier reports, she says her pastor had been returning from a trip when she met the said girls at the travel agency.

They were being scrambled over by commercial bike riders, when she intervened.



“She entered the car to go but lost peace. Her spirit told her these children are not okay…”

When quizzed, the kids are said to have been brought to Yaounde by a certain Nancy.

After being compelled to, the girls have the contacts of their parents in Bamenda who were then contacted.



“The children spoke with their parents … ” Nkwain Irene states, saying they did so under hard struggle.

They were then taken to the church before being handed to a Gendarmerie in the locality for their parents and guardians to come get them.
